The Free Will Players Theatre Guild is seeking a hands-on and detail-oriented Scenic Carpenter to join our team for the 2026 Freewill Shakespeare Festival. This paid student position is funded through the Canada Summer Jobs program and is open to applicants between the ages of 15 and 30, making it ideal for someone interested in scenic construction, carpentry, or technical theatre who is looking to gain hands-on experience in a collaborative outdoor performance environment.
About the Role
The Scenic Carpenter supports the construction and installation of scenic elements for the Freewill Shakespeare Festival. Working closely with the Production Manager and Set Designer, this role contributes directly to building the physical environment that brings each production to life.
This position is designed as a mentored learning opportunity, offering practical experience in scenic construction, tool use, installation, and production workflow. The Scenic Carpenter will develop technical skills while working as part of a collaborative team in a fast-paced festival setting.
Key Responsibilities
Assist in building, assembling, and preparing scenic elements as designed for the productions
Operate hand and power tools safely, following all required safety protocols and site procedures
Participate in load-in and on-site installation of scenic elements
Assist with strike, ensuring materials and equipment are safely dismantled and returned to storage
Maintain tools, equipment, and workspaces to ensure safety and efficiency throughout the build process
Collaborate with other production departments, including props, scenic paint, and stage management
Identify and communicate potential construction or installation issues to the Production Manager
Support material preparation and organization to facilitate efficient workflow
Follow all safety standards, including the use of appropriate personal protective equipment (PPE)
Participate in safety briefings and assist with maintaining a safe work environment

Contract Details
Start Date: May 25, 2026
End Date: July 17, 2026
Pay: $18 per hour
Hours: 35 hours/week
Eligibility: Must meet Canada Summer Jobs Requirements for Employment
be between 15 and 30 years old at the start of their summer job
be a Canadian citizen, permanent resident, or person to whom refugee protection has been conferred under the Immigration and Refugee Protection Act for the duration of the job and
be legally entitled to work in Canada in accordance with relevant provincial or territorial legislation and regulations
this includes having a valid Social Insurance Number at the start of their summer job
